Purpose:
- Approximately 8 - 10% of adults in Ravalli County and 10 - 12% of adults in Missoula County live below the poverty line. Poverty on the nearby Flathead Reservation, home to the Selis, Qlispe, and Kootenai people, affects more than 20% of the adult population. Travelers' Rest State Park provides opportunities for Indigenous artisans to demonstrate and sell their work. The Park also brings visitors from across the country, encouraging tourist spending at restaurants, breweries, gas stations, and lodging in Lolo and beyond. By expanding the audience for park programs through social media, marketing, and outreach, the VISTA position can help increase income for local business owners and employment opportunities at those businesses.
- Travelers' Rest Connection has just one one part-time employee - its Executive Director. Any expansion of program revenue or fundraising can help build capacity to hire additional staff. By promoting event participation, the VISTA member can increase demand for programs and revenue, ultimately resulting in greater capacity to develop new programs.

Travelers' Rest State Park is located in Lolo, Montana about 10 miles from the larger city of Missoula. Travelers' Rest Connection supports the park through outreach, advocacy, and educational experiences connecting the past to the future. An AmeriCorps VISTA position at Travelers' Rest will provide opportunities to learn new skills in event planning, interpretation, and marketing/outreach. The VISTA will represent Travelers' Rest at a variety of community events like farmers' markets and festivals, leading hands-on history activities and distributing information about the park and programs. They will coordinate demonstration days with Indigenous artists at Travelers' Rest State Park. The VISTA will also create a portfolio of social media posts and event flyers to expand audiences for public programs and fundraising events.
